Kinds Of Ford Car Keys
Before diving into the costs, it's crucial to compare the kinds of keys used in Ford Mondeo Key Replacement vehicles. Each type has its own replacement process and associated expenses. Here's a breakdown:
Key TypeDescriptionCommon Replacement Ford Car Keys CostTraditional KeyFundamental metal key without electronic parts₤ 50 - ₤ 200Transponder KeyKey with an ingrained chip that interacts with the car's ignition system₤ 100 - ₤ 300Key FobRemote control key with buttons for locking/unlocking and starting the car₤ 150 - ₤ 400Smart KeyAdvanced keyless entry system that enables push-button start₤ 300 - ₤ 800Key Descriptions
Conventional Key: This is an easy metal key that most older Ford designs use. While they are easy to replicate, replacing a lost key can still sustain costs if you require a locksmith professional.

Transponder Key: Modern Ford Keyless Fob Replacement cars typically utilize transponder keys, which include a little chip that improves security. These keys must be set to deal with the lorry, contributing to higher replacement costs.

Key Fob: These wise gadgets not only open your car however may also have additional features such as remote start and panic buttons. Programming is likewise necessary, resulting in increased expenses.

Smart Key: Vehicles that use push-to-start performance usually featured wise keys. These modern options frequently need specific programming and can cost substantially more to replace.
Breakdown of Replacement Costs
Replacing a Ford car key involves numerous factors, consisting of the kind of key, labor expenses, and whether you select to go through a car dealership or a locksmith professional. Below is an in-depth breakdown of replacement expenses:
Cost FactorDescriptionEstimated CostKey TypeSee table above for key type costs₤ 50 - ₤ 800Programming FeeCharge for programming the key to your Ford vehicle₤ 50 - ₤ 100Labor CostsCharges for locksmith professional or car dealership labor₤ 25 - ₤ 75Extra FeaturesExtra functions (e.g., remote start) can contribute to costs₤ 20 - ₤ 100Overall Replacement Cost Estimation
To provide a clearer picture, here is a rough quote of overall costs based on the kind of key:
Key TypeTotal Estimated Cost (Including Programming)Traditional Key₤ 50 - ₤ 275Transponder Key₤ 150 - ₤ 400Key Fob₤ 200 - ₤ 500Smart Key₤ 350 - ₤ 900Aspects Influencing the Cost of Replacement
Comprehending the various elements that can affect the general cost of replacing Ford car keys is essential for budgeting efficiently. Here are a few of these elements:

Vehicle Model and Year: The kind of key and its programming requirements often alter with newer designs, which can affect cost.

Dealership vs. Locksmith: Generally, car dealerships may charge higher rates due to their brand credibility and direct access to OEM parts. Independent locksmiths may use lower rates however can still supply top quality service.

Location: Costs can vary significantly by area due to distinctions in labor rates and need for locksmith professional services.

Additional Services: If the key has unique features like remote start or innovative security, anticipate increased costs for programming and parts.

Key Availability: If the key is unusual or out of stock, you might deal with longer wait times and extra shipping charges.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How long does it require to change a Ford car key?
The time needed depends upon whether you go to a dealership or a locksmith professional. Most of the times, it can take anywhere from 15 minutes to a couple of hours.
2. Can I change my Ford car key myself?
While it's possible to change specific kinds of keys yourself, jobs such as programming the key typically require professional equipment.
3. What if I have lost all keys to my Ford car?
If you've lost all keys, a car dealership may need to create a new key from your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), which can be more costly and time-consuming.
4. Exist any DIY alternatives for key replacement?
Do it yourself alternatives exist for conventional keys, however for keys that need programming (like transponder keys or fobs), it's a good idea to seek advice from an expert.
5. Is key replacement covered under guarantee or insurance coverage?
Inspect your car's warranty and your insurance coverage policy. Some extensive plans may offer protection for key replacement.
